Samourai Wallet Founders Arrested for Over $100 Million Money Laundering
1
SHARES
Share on TwitterShare on Reddit

• U.S. authorities have arrested Keonne Rodriguez and William Lonergan Hill, founders of Bitcoin mixer Samourai Wallet
• They are charged with conspiracy to commit money laundering
• Samourai Wallet’s server and web domain have been seized

US authorities have arrested and charged the founders of Bitcoin mixer Samourai Wallet, accusing them of conspiracy to commit money laundering. The arrests come as authorities ramp up efforts to crack down on services that aim to obscure the flow of cryptocurrencies.

Details of the Charges

The US Attorney’s Office for the Southern District of New York announced on Wednesday that Keonne Rodriguez and William Lonergan Hill were charged with operating a cryptocurrency mixer that executed over $2 billion in unlawful transactions. The mixer also facilitated more than $100 million in money laundering transactions from illegal dark web markets, according to the statement.

Both Rodriguez and Hill have been arrested, and Samourai’s server and web domain have been seized.

Authorities Crack Down on Mixers

Cryptocurrency mixers or tumblers are services that attempt to obscure the origin of digital assets by mixing potentially identifiable crypto funds with others. This makes it harder to trace the flow of funds back to any specific user.

Authorities have been ramping up efforts to crack down on mixers and other anonymity services. This includes sanctioning certain mixing services and exchanges that list privacy coins.

Critics argue that restricting mixers harms user privacy and could make using cryptocurrency dangerous for those living under authoritarian regimes. Supporters say restrictions are necessary to prevent illicit activity.

The charges against the founders of Samourai Wallet represent the latest salvo in this ongoing battle between authorities and privacy services. The case will likely renew debate around balancing privacy and law enforcement in the cryptocurrency space.

Conclusion

The arrests of the founders of Samourai Wallet show authorities are continuing efforts to restrict anonymity services in order to better track the flow of funds on blockchains. However, privacy remains a core value for many in crypto, so tensions around these restrictions are likely to persist.
